The Government of Arunachal Pradesh on April 06, 2026, issued ban on Fishing Activities during Monsoon Season in Lower Dibang Valley District (April–September 2026).
In view of the monsoon season (April to September), which is a critical breeding period for fish, authorities have imposed a complete ban on all fishing activities in open waters across Lower Dibang Valley District. The decision has been taken due to the alarming decline in fish stocks in natural water bodies.
The ban, issued under the Arunachal Pradesh Fisheries Act, 2006, applies to all forms of fishing, including traditional methods, with the objective of allowing fish populations to regenerate and restore ecological balance.
This measure follows earlier directions issued on March 31, 2026, and is aimed at ensuring sustainable fisheries management by replenishing depleted fish resources in the district.
